PlaneSense, Inc. is a privately held fractional aircraft ownership company that manages a growing fleet of turboprop and jet aircraft. More than 550+ employees handle all aspects of management, operations, scheduling, aircraft maintenance, quality assurance, and administration. The PlaneSense® program fleet is maintained through our award-winning service centers, Atlas Aircraft Center, Inc.

As one of the leading fractional aircraft companies in the United States, PlaneSense, Inc. manages the largest civilian fleet of Pilatus PC-12s in the world and a growing fleet of Pilatus PC-24 twin engine jets. The PlaneSense® program operates in the continental United States, Canada, Bermuda, the Bahamas, the Caribbean, Mexico, and Central America with continuous expansion. PlaneSense, Inc. is dedicated to the highest standards of owner services, safety, and reliability.

Atlas Aircraft Center, Inc. (AAC) is a Pilatus authorized fleet service and support center for the PlaneSense® fractional fleet. As an FAA certified Part 145 repair station, we specialize in Pilatus PC-12 turboprop aircraft and Pilatus PC-24 twin engine jet aircraft support, including turbine aircraft repairs, annual inspections, phase inspections, hourly inspections, modifications, and Service Bulletin compliance, as well as Avionics repairs and sales.

Atlas Aircraft Center is part of the PlaneSense, Inc. headquarters in Portsmouth, NH. Our state-of-the-art, 40,000 square foot hangar is equipped with slab heating, high-tech lighting, and Megadoors. These special fabric doors provide superior insulation capabilities to protect staff from inclement weather while also shielding customers’ aircraft from the elements. The very high ceilings and door openings accommodate all types of aircraft. An additional 44,000 square feet is dedicated to shop space and corporate offices.

Our Nevada maintenance facility is located in Boulder City, NV and features 36,000 square feet of air-conditioned hangar space. This Atlas Aircraft Center facility provides valuable support for the PlaneSense® fleet, mainly serving fractional share clients in the Western part of the U.S.
